What are FMCG service providers?

Fast Moving Consumer Goods (FMCG) service providers are companies that specialize in supplying, distributing, and managing consumer products that have a high turnover rate and are typically sold at a relatively low cost. These products include items such as food and beverages, personal care products, household goods, and other everyday consumables.FMCG service providers play a crucial role in the supply chain by ensuring that these products reach consumers efficiently and effectively. They often work closely with manufacturers, retailers, wholesalers, and logistics companies to streamline the distribution process and meet consumer demand in a timely manner.Some common services provided by FMCG service providers include:

  1. Distribution and Logistics: Managing the transportation, storage, and delivery of FMCG products to retailers, supermarkets, convenience stores, and other points of sale.
  2. Inventory Management: Monitoring and optimizing inventory levels to prevent stockouts, reduce wastage, and improve supply chain efficiency.
  3. Marketing and Promotion: Developing marketing strategies, promotional campaigns, and point-of-sale materials to increase product visibility and drive sales.
  4. Merchandising: Ensuring that products are displayed prominently and attractively in retail outlets to enhance the shopping experience and boost sales.
  5. Category Management: Analyzing consumer trends, market data, and sales performance to optimize product assortment, pricing, and placement within retail stores.

FMCG service providers play a pivotal role in the success of FMCG brands by helping them reach a wide consumer base, increase brand awareness, and drive sales growth. Their expertise in supply chain management, distribution, marketing, and merchandising can make a significant impact on the overall performance of FMCG products in the market.
